| Cleaning some cast iron (Posted on 1/19/13 at 3:14 pm)
I have a small cast iron skillet that had a sticky surface in part of the bottom. I made a big fire in my barrel and got the pan warm, hung over the top of the barrel on a strip of rebar. Once the pan was hot enough not to crack, I put it down into the coals for about an hour. I watched as the gunk burned off. After about an hour, I hung it across the top again to start the cool down process. I will brush it down and reseason it tomorrow. IT should be smooth enough to make cornbread in it again, without the bread sticking.

tigeryat  LSU Fan God's Country Member since Oct 2005 2400 posts

| re: Cleaning some cast iron (Posted on 1/19/13 at 7:45 pm to Hermit Crab)
quote:
What's the difference between new cast iron and old cast iron?
All the new ones have a rough bottom. No matter how well it is seasoned, the inside bottom of the pots have a rough, cement like feel to them. The old ones are smooth as a baby's behind.
|
| Back to top | |
ADLSUNSU  LSU Fan Baton Rouge Member since Sep 2007 3165 posts
Online

| re: Cleaning some cast iron (Posted on 1/19/13 at 8:26 pm to tigeryat)
Yea it was the casting process that the old Griswolds used. Some of the ones that are very old and been used for a long time are also nearing in smoothness. I use electrolysis instead of a fire (too risky to warp or damage) I need to start getting rid of the ones that collected to sell. But each one starts to feel special and unique lol
